Highest poker hand ranking wins the game

This article explains about the winning poker hands after all the betting is done. The first step to decide the winning hand is to get a look at all the players’ cards. For this article we are assuming a usual five-card poker hand. The player with the highest poker hand ranking wins. Cards can hold one of the following ranks in ascending arrange: 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, and 10, Jack, Queen, King, and Ace. The suit of a card will be Hearts, Diamonds, Clubs or Spades.

For straight flushes, flushes, straights, and nothing, the hand holding the highest card wins. Thus, the straight Q-J-10-9-8 defeats the straight J-10-9-8-7. It would as well defeat 5-4-3-2-A, as the ace is being employed as a low card in this instance.

If there is a tie among high cards, the second-highest cards are evaluated, and so on descending, until one card is higher than one more. For instance, the flush A-10-4-3-2 defeats the flush A-9-8-7-6 as the 10 is higher than the 9. If all five cards are equal except for suit, the hands are identical and the pot is divided evenly among the winning players. For instance, a royal flush in spades would tie with a royal flush in diamonds.

For four of a kind and three of a kind, the hand with the higher ranking corresponding set succeeds; 7-7-7-3-2 defeats 6-6-6-A-K for the reason that sevens are higher than sixes. Matchless cards matter just if the sets are identical; K-K-J-3-2 defeats K-K-9-8-7 as the jack defeats the 9 in all poker games.
